6. Serious?
The song is awesome. One of the best folk songs written in the past twenty years in my opinion.

This particular version? Not so great. It's a typical bluegrass adaptation and not inspirationally performed. Del McCoury is a legend for his history and reputation, but he does nothing for this song. I don't see him as a tragically injured man giving his lover a bike that, until he was injured, he loved more than any woman before her.

12. I'm a big bluegrass fan, but I'm a bigger folksinger fan.
Richard Thompson's version -- particularly versions strictly solo acoustic -- are just pure examples of what makes folk music work at its purest form. His song, his story, his music (with no one else's immediate contribution) deliver the story and the art as directly as possible.

I love a wide variety of music, but when it's as pure and direct as possible -- inspiration --> songwriting --> performance -- I don't think you can often top it.
